我正在處理C#應用程序中的excel文件。 我不知道爲什麼這個代碼不工作: var value1 = ws.Range[ws.Cells[7,4]].Value;
現在我發現這工作得很好: int i = 7;
var value1 = ws.Range["D" + i.ToString()].Value;
我在Excel工作表中具有以下宏 - 它檢索由其醫院編號標識的患者,並將姓氏放在一列中,此工作正常。 我現在需要在工作表中插入更多數據,但是當姓氏出現時,其他數據不會。 我沒有問題寫入相同的單元格到左側的單元格,但是當我嘗試寫入右側的列時,什麼都不會發生。 該表未受保護,它不是字體和單元格背景爲白色的情況。有任何想法嗎? Private Sub Worksheet_Change(ByVal Tar